Sign In — Free (10 views/day)EVELYN ABRAHAMS SCHOLARSHIP FUND, founded in 1977, is a small nonprofit in the Education sector that reported $106K in total revenue in fiscal year 2018. Revenue surged 38%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. Expenses of $127K exceeded revenue, resulting in a 20% operating deficit.
TO PROVIDE SCHOLARSHIPS TO THE GRADUATES OF DINWIDDIE HIGH SCHOOL.
